Tinny Puppy Question Our girl Tink hand three pups this round and one is very tinny they are 13 weeks old and she weighs 10-11 oz and her two other sisters weigh 2.2 pounds, as this is the first time we have had one this small my question is how long will it take for her to catch up with her sisters. She is very active and loves to play but if she dosn't eat or get fed every 2- 3 hours she get very weak, she also hardly ever drinks water. Any advice will be appreciated. Note: Not catch up to her sisters in size I know that not going to happen, talking about the eating. |
I would make sure she is fed well...do not allow her to go without food for more then a couple hours...repeated spells of hypoglycemia can cause brain damage and it drains the tiny pups resources...try to prevent it. I would not let her go to a new home until she was at least 6 months and bile acid test could be done with assurance she does not have liver shunt. I would hope by a full pound she will be more stable, but that is iffy...age is your best friend with a puppy like this...others will post lots of good advise. I would feed her whatever she will eat..chicken, beef, cheese, high quality canned food and dry..Nutracal several times daily. Good Luck |

Goats milk is so good..I wean my pups with it...also a UK product called Dyne is excellent for putting weight on tinies..most dog suppliers carry it..it tastes like Eagle Brand evaporated milk..very thick and mine lick it easily. |
